Movie Overview: Der Magdalenenbaum

MovieDer Magdalenenbaum
Release Year1989
DirectorRainer Behrend
GenreDrama
Runtime84 minutes (1h 24m)
LanguageDE

Story & Plot Summary: Der Magdalenenbaum

Quick Plot Summary: Released in 1989, Der Magdalenenbaum is a Drama film directed by Rainer Behrend, written by Rainer Behrend. Ending Explained: Der Magdalenenbaum

Der Magdalenenbaum Ending Explained: The young sailor Felix Striebel goes on vacation to a village and visits the fresh grave of "Mother Magda". Directed by Rainer Behrend, this 1989 drama film stars Christine Schorn, alongside Christian Steyer, Thomas Stecher, Dagmar Manzel as Rosie.
